Output c96705188f20b0cbc7ff13490dedf032cf2efe9c283b520666754755c290d701:14

value
1030622
script pubkey
OP_0 OP_PUSHBYTES_20 3bab6aacf0bad691e47c115ece01dd177cb8c9ad
address
bc1q8w4k4t8shttfreruz90vuqwaza7t3jdd2cck24
transaction
c96705188f20b0cbc7ff13490dedf032cf2efe9c283b520666754755c290d701
confirmations
705
spent
true